#============================================================================== # SEのランダム再生 #  # 指定された配列からSEをランダムで再生します。 # # # 起動方法 #  スクリプトに以下のように記述してください。 #   play_rand_se(array,vol,sp) #    array:再生するSEを指定します。配列で指定してください。 #    vol:SEのボリュームを指定します。 #    sp:SEのスピードを指定します。 # # 利用規約 #  連絡不要 #  商用可 # 改造可 # 再配布可(無改造の場合はクレジットを消さないでください) # アダルト可 #  利用された際、クレジットはあると喜びます  # #                       by 3dpose #                       http://customsaga.wiki.fc2.com/ # #                       GY. Materials #                       http://gymaterials.jp/ # #============================================================================== # ■ Game_Interpreter #------------------------------------------------------------------------------ #  イベントコマンドを実行するインタプリタです。このクラスは Game_Map クラス、 # Game_Troop クラス、Game_Event クラスの内部で使用されます。 #============================================================================== class Game_Interpreter #-------------------------------------------------------------------------- # ● SEのランダム再生 #  arrayにはSEの名称を配列で代入してください。 #-------------------------------------------------------------------------- def play_rand_se(array,vol,sp) se = "Audio/SE/" se += array[rand(array.size)] Audio.se_play(se, vol, sp) end end